How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 98402?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
98402 Studio Apartments | $1,571 | $564 | $2,954 |
98402 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,985 | $589 | $4,926 |
98402 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,388 | $589 | $5,499 |
98402 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,135 | $1,403 | $5,790 |
98402 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,329 | $2,650 | $6,870 |
